Vimeo のホスティングモデルが、クリエイターにとってこのプラットフォームを思慮深い場にしているのと同時に、単純なダウンローダーを苦しめる原因にもなっています。公開動画は再生時に署名済みセグメント URL を取得する HLS プレイヤーの背後にあります。非公開動画はそこにセッション Cookie の要件を重ねます。パスワード保護動画はさらに前段のフォームを足します。Vimeo OTT のサブスクリプションチャンネルは Widevine DRM を加えます。各階層はそれぞれ異なるアクセス形態であり、ダウンローダーはそのすべてを扱えなければ、最も単純な公開ケースでしか動かないことになります。
VidMost は Vimeo に対して 3 つの連携した捕捉モードでアプローチします。第一に、スマートスニッファー内の Vimeo アダプターが player.vimeo.com / vimeocdn.com からの master.m3u8 を認識し、検出した各バリアントを右サイドバーに列挙し、推奨ベストマッチをハイライトします。第二に、内蔵ブラウザが Vimeo の要求するアクセス状態 — サインイン、パスワード、埋め込みリファラー — を処理し、プレイヤーを描画してアダプターが正しいマニフェストを目にできるようにします。第三に、カーネル録画モードが DRM 保護ページに対するフォールバックで、再生中の動画の上にフローティングツールバーが現れ、レコーダーが再生中にそのストリームを捕捉します。これは Widevine L3 タイトルに対してマニフェストがどう保護されていても機能します。公開 Vimeo 動画にはアダプター単体で十分、非公開レビューリンクにはブラウザ+アダプターで対応、L3 保護の Vimeo OTT にはカーネルレコーダーがフォールバックです。Widevine L1(ハードウェア結合)は 3 つのモードのいずれにもサポートされません。